Puma Spring - Hours & Locations
Puma - Houston
4322 Texas 6, Houston TX 77084 Phone Number:(281) 550-1486Hours may fluctuate
Distance:22.03 miles
Puma - Houston
5015 Westheimer Galleria Mall, Houston TX Phone Number:(832) 492-0843Hours may fluctuate
Distance:22.15 miles
Puma - Houston
6590 Woodway Dr., Houston TX 77057 Phone Number:(713) 465-0033Hours may fluctuate
Distance:23.08 miles
Puma - Houston
1953 West Gray, Houston TX 77019 Phone Number:(713) 529-0786Hours may fluctuate
Distance:23.33 miles
Puma - Houston
5085 Westheimer Rd., Space 3595b, Houston TX 77056 Phone Number:(713) 623-4723Hours may fluctuate
Distance:23.65 miles
Puma - Houston
5085 Westheimer Rd, Houston TX 77056 Phone Number:(713) 877-1867Hours may fluctuate
Distance:23.65 miles
Puma - Houston
5115 Westheimer Rd, Houston TX 77056Hours may fluctuate
Distance:23.66 miles
Puma - Houston
2110 Richmond Ave, Houston TX 77098 Phone Number:(713) 524-6662Hours may fluctuate
Distance:23.92 miles
Puma - Houston
2408 Rice Blvd., Houston TX 77005 Phone Number:(713) 520-6353Hours may fluctuate
Distance:25.08 miles
Puma - Houston
2416 Times Blvd, Houston TX 77005 Phone Number:(713) 523-8825Hours may fluctuate
Distance:25.14 miles